Transaction 640b9898b04210b38d230d492a898b57f2e435a5fd82d05c285723e33c0b9373
1 Input
2 Outputs
- 640b9898b04210b38d230d492a898b57f2e435a5fd82d05c285723e33c0b9373:0
- 640b9898b04210b38d230d492a898b57f2e435a5fd82d05c285723e33c0b9373:1
value 3189814
address 17nGx2iS2wprkMGVPzSiqDJEUH3r9EGeYP
value 9840000
address 34uabFwk54z76uxeFTydMaEsuoP4vdgzcW